From 9cdac9657fda58ae39c2bbc8be396f5530ed8398 Mon Sep 17 00:00:00 2001 From: Ulrich Kunitz Date: Fri, 1 Dec 2006 00:58:07 +0000 Subject: [PATCH] zd1211rw: Support for multicast addresses Support for multicast adresses is implemented by supporting the set_multicast_list() function of the network device. Address filtering is supported by a group hash table in the device. This is based on earlier work by Benoit Papillaut.
